Mt Maria College Petrie is a Catholic Archdiocesan Co-Educational Secondary College.
The College was established by Brisbane Catholic Education in 1987.
Central to our existence is the genuine concern for each student’s academic, spiritual and personal development. Promoting our Catholic Marist faith, personal formation and building confidence and self-esteem are paramount to our College community. There is a strong sense of family spirit and a great support for our College Mission.
Nestled on four hectares of gardens and bushland, Mt Maria College Petrie offers a dynamic and responsive curriculum to meet the educational needs of our students. It is located next to Our Lady of the Way Primary school and Our Lady of the Way Parish, Petrie.

We offer a variety of extra-curricular opportunities that enrich our students’ education. Sport, The Arts, Community Service, Leadership, and Technologies make up a small part of these offerings.
Our comprehensive sporting program includes swimming, athletics, cross-country, and a variety of Team sports at both College and Regional Representative level.
Our Marist Game Changes program and Student Representative Council provide students the opportunity to give back to the community and develop their leadership skills.
For those whose passion extends to The Arts, our college band, choir, instrumental program, dance troupe, and our Luminare Art extension program will be sure to provide many fulfilling experiences.
Students participate in year level camps, retreats and subject excursions, which serve to enhance their learning experiences outside the classroom. These activities allow students to explore their interests, gain self-confidence and develop their skills socially, emotionally, physically and academically.
PASTORAL CARE
Pastoral Care at MMCP embodies the nurturing ethos of faith, compassion, service and community rooted in the teachings of Jesus Christ through the guidance of our Patron Saints, St Marcellin Champagnat, St Maximillian Kolbe, St Louise de Marillac and St Mary of the Cross MacKillop.
WELLBEING
Pastoral Care extends beyond academic achievement to encompass the holistic wellbeing of students. It fosters a supportive environment where students feel valued, heard and understood and cultivates character, resilience and empathy.
LEADERSHIP
We champion leadership formation and opportunities across all year levels including the Student Representative Council (SRC), Student Leadership Team (SLT) and the Australian wide Marist Youth Formation program - Game Changers.
SERVICE
We provide opportunities for service such as Care to Cook, Breakfast Club, Meet & Greet Breaky, Emmanuel City Mission, Eat Up! and fundraising for Caritas, Marist Solidarity and St Vincent de Paul.
